The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Henry Bayes, born in 1848 in Norfolk, consisted of 7 members. Henry was the head of the household, married to Jane Bayes, born in 1847 in Chelsea, Middlesex, England. They had 5 children; Annie J (born 1874 in Kensington, Middlesex, England), Freddy J (born 1876 in Battersea, Surrey, England), Sidney G (born 1877 in Chelsea, Middlesex, England), Florence L (born 1879 in Chelsea, Middlesex, England) and Minnie C (born 1880 in Chelsea, Middlesex, England).
